    SHAREHOLDER OF DOGHAGORTS 1 COMPANY BRINGS SUIT AGAINST ARMENIAN GOVERNMENT BEFORE LONDON COURT OF INTERNATIONAL ARBITRATION

    Noyan Tapan
    Jun 01 2007

    YEREVAN, JUNE 1, NOYAN TAPAN. In accordance with the decision made
    by the Armenian government at the May 31 sitting and the RA Law on
    Prosecutor's Office, the RA ministry of trade and economic development
    was reserved the authority to protect the interests of the Republic
    of Armenia in connection with the suit brought against the RA by
    TS Investment Corp.- shareholder of Doghagorts 1 OJSC (Tyre Plant)
    before the London Court of International Arbitration.

    NT was informed from the RA Government Information and PR Department
    that the RA minister of trade and economic development was reserved
    the right to sign, with the aim of ensuring the protection of rights
    of the RA in connection with the above mentioned suit, an agreement
    with legal advisor - Manatt, Phelps & Philips company. It is noted
    that Doghagorts 1 company's shareholder TS Investment Corp. was to make
    investments of 12-13 million dollars in Armenia but it wants to decline
    to fulfill its obligations. For this reason TS Investment Corp. has
    brought a suit before the London Court of International Arbitration.
